Trinity Baseball Steals First of Three-Game Series at No. 23 Tufts

MEDFORD, Mass. – Junior Brandon Chow (Greenwich, Conn.) went 3-for-3 and senior Jimmy Fahey (Danbury, Conn.) pitched a complete game to lead the Trinity College baseball team to a 2-1 win over No. 23 ranked Tufts University on Friday afternoon in New England Small College Athletic Conference (NESCAC) competition.  The Bantams improve to 13-12 on the year with a 5-2 mark in the conference and resume action tomorrow against the Jumbos (19-7, 4-5 NESCAC) with a double-header starting at noon. 
 
Trinity scored both runs in the top of the third as sophomore James Stefanowicz (Stamford, Conn.) doubled to center field to lead things off for the Blue and Gold. Two batters later, Chow pushed Stefanowicz to third with an infield single and later advanced to second while Stefanowicz took home on a passed ball for the first run of the day. Moments later, first-year Tanner Fairchild (Sarasota, Fla.) then gave the visitors a two-run lead with an RBI single to left field to score Chow from third. 
 
The Jumbos added its lone run of the day in the fifth when Jackson Duffy singled to left field to score Kyle Cortese. Fahey earned his second win of the season on the mound, pitching his first complete game of his career and striking out four batters on the afternoon.
